Sheila Manahan was born in Dublin in 1924.   Her film debut was in the Irish filmed “Another Shore”.   She went on to have a career in British films.   Her movies included the excellent “Seven Days to Noon” in 1950, “Footsteps in the Fog”, “The Story of Esther Costello” with Joan Crawford and “Only Two Can Play” with Peter Sellers.   She was long married to the wonderful Scottish actor Fultan McCoy.   Sheila Manahan died in 1988.
